Transaction

6fb5af529a295a42e1fc9cb141c8af80d62c05dc433b0fdc2a2e9556dade73a0
397,932 confirmations
Timestamp
1538318714
Block543,773
Fee50,177 sats
Fee rate39.8 sats/vB
view on mempool.space

Inputs & Outputs